Emulating Disney/Pixar Charm: Three-Dimensional Moving Processes Explained
To produce the stunning visuals we associate with Pixar movies, technicians employ a intricate suite of 3D animation processes. The process usually begins with creating characters and environments in applications like Maya or Blender, establishing their shape and appearance. Next, setup – fundamentally creating a virtual structure – permits artists to pose them. This input afterward flows into rendering engines like RenderMan, which replicates authentic lighting, dark areas, and materials. Finally, combining applications mixes all these elements into the completed scene.
